本文目录导读:
图片来源于网络,如有侵权联系删除
Window MySQL 服务器的时间设置对于数据库性能和同步至关重要,本文将深入探讨Window MySQL 服务器时间的配置、常见问题以及如何进行优化。
在当今数字化时代,数据是企业的核心资产,MySQL 作为一款广泛使用的开源关系型数据库管理系统(RDBMS),因其高性能、高可靠性和易用性而受到众多开发者的青睐,MySQL 服务器的运行效率不仅取决于硬件资源,还与其时间设置密切相关,准确且一致的时间管理能够确保数据的完整性和一致性,避免因时差导致的错误和冲突。
Window MySQL 服务器时间的配置
时间同步服务
Window 操作系统自带了一个名为“Windows Time Service”的服务,该服务默认使用 Network Time Protocol (NTP) 来校准计算机时间,为了确保 Window MySQL 服务器的时间准确性,我们需要确保这个服务正常运行。
启动 Windows Time 服务
- 打开“控制面板”,选择“系统和安全”。
- 点击“Administrative Tools”(管理工具)。
- 在“Services”中找到“Windows Time”服务,右键点击并选择“Start”以启动该服务。
配置 NTP 服务器
- 右键点击“Windows Time”服务,选择“Properties”。
- 在“General”标签页下,勾选“Allow the service to interact with the computer's desktop”复选框。
- 切换到“Time Providers”标签页,点击“Add”按钮添加新的 NTP 服务器地址,可以使用公共 NTP 服务器如 pool.ntp.org。
手动调整时间
在某些情况下,可能需要手动调整 Window MySQL 服务器的时间,这通常发生在网络不稳定或无法连接外部 NTP 服务器时。
手动设置时间
- 打开命令提示符(cmd),输入以下命令:
w32tm /config /manualsync /syncfromflags: demand
- 重启“Windows Time”服务以确保更改生效。
常见问题及解决方法
时间不一致导致的数据冲突
由于不同节点之间时间差异可能导致数据写入冲突,因此保持所有节点的时钟同步至关重要,可以通过定期检查各节点的时钟并进行必要的校正来预防此类问题。
NTP 服务器不可达
当尝试连接外部 NTP 服务器失败时,可以考虑使用本地 NTP 服务器或者备用 NTP 服务器作为替代方案。
图片来源于网络,如有侵权联系删除
解决方案:
- 使用本地 NTP 服务器:可以在内部网络中选择一台稳定的主机作为 NTP 服务器,并将其设置为其他机器的时间源。
- 备用 NTP 服务器:为关键应用准备多个备用的 NTP 服务器地址,以防主服务器不可用时自动切换。
Window MySQL 服务器时间的优化
除了基本的时间同步外,还可以通过一些策略进一步优化 Window MySQL 服务器的性能和时间管理:
定期备份和恢复测试
定期对数据进行备份并进行恢复测试可以验证系统的可靠性,同时也能及时发现潜在的时间同步问题。
监控工具的使用
利用专业的监控工具(如 Nagios、Zabbix 等)实时监测 Window MySQL 服务器的时间状态,以便于快速响应异常情况。
硬件升级
如果发现时间同步存在延迟或不稳定性,考虑更换更高性能的网络设备和更稳定的电源供应器以提高整体系统的稳定性。
Window MySQL 服务器的时间管理对于保证数据库的高效运行和数据的一致性至关重要,通过合理配置时间同步服务和采取相应的优化措施,可以有效提升系统的稳定性和可靠性,在实际操作中,应结合具体环境和需求灵活运用上述方法和技巧,以达到最佳效果。
标签: #window mysql 服务器的时间
评论列表